Showing posts from July, 2010

Manually installing jars in Maven Repository

Occasionally we stumble upon a situation where in we may find dependency of a jar that falls under the following category: it is propriety jar file which will never be part of maven repository it is not in official maven repository, for whatever reason it be In this situation, you add this jar (“install” in Maven’s jargon) to your local Maven repository. How do you do this? If you know and\or understand the layout of the maven repository, you can copy the jar directly into where it is meant to go. Maven will find this file next time it is run. If you are not confident about the layout of the maven repository, then you can adapt the command below to load in your jar file. mvn install:install-file -Dfile=<path-to-file> -DgroupId=<group-id> -DartifactId=<artifact-id> -Dversion=<version> -Dpackaging=<packaging> -DgeneratePom=true Where:  <path-to-file> the path to the file to load <group-id> the group that the file sho